Penerapan Sistem Informasi Manajemen Untuk Meningkatkan Efektivitas Pelayanan Administrasi Desa Dahana Bawodesolo

Abstract

The era of globalization has had a significant impact on various aspects of life, including in the field of village government which is required to be able to provide effective and efficient public services. Advances in information technology have also encouraged the importance of implementing Management Information Systems (SIM) as an instrument for improving organizational performance, including in the implementation of village government administration. This research aims to analyze the implementation of the Village Information System (SID) through the SIKS-NG application in increasing the effectiveness of administrative services in Dahana Bawodesolo Village. The research method used is descriptive with a qualitative approach, which is supported by observations and interviews with village officials and the community. Preliminary results show that even though the implementation of SID has been implemented, its use is still not optimal due to low public understanding and limited supporting resources, such as technological infrastructure and user competence. This research uses Davis' information management theory and the organizational effectiveness approach as the basis for analysis. It is hoped that this research can contribute to developing strategies for improving information technology-based public services at the village government level and provide an overview for policy makers in strengthening human resource capacity and village digital infrastructure. The novelty of this research lies in its focus on optimizing the use of the SIKS-NG application as part of a village information system in the context of village government administration services in the digital era.
